Webb11 juli 2024 · How many CEUs is Tncc? For TNCC, RNs will receive 3.25 contact hours for completing the pre-course work and an evaluation and 13 contact hours after … WebbNursing Continuing Education This course is held in cooperation with the University of Iowa Hospitals & Clinics Department of Nursing, an Iowa Board of Nursing approved provider Number 34. 18.3 Nursing contact hours will be awarded at the successful completion of the full TNCC course.

When do I need to … chlorinated bagWebbThe TNCC™ (provider) course is a 16-hour course designed to provide cognitive knowledge and psychomotor skills. TNCC offers current core-level knowledge, refines skills and builds a firm foundation in trauma nursing.
